通过拉取请求解决合并冲突

时间:2020-08-26 17:00:23

标签: git version-control bitbucket pull-request

我有两个分支,其中Master反映了Production,并且当前发行版本的分支(我们称为Sprint)是所有开发人员的基础分支进行中的发行。在这两个分支上,我都有权限设置,其中没有更改将直接推入而无需使用Pull Request

现在,我需要将Master合并到Sprint中,但是当我这样做时,我合并了冲突

由于我无法直接将任何东西推到Sprint上,我该如何解决这些冲突?

1 个答案:

答案 0 :(得分:2)

您可以:

在您的本地仓库中:

  • 从主人那里创建一个workbranch
  • Sprint合并到workbranchgit merge Sprint
  • 解决冲突(与拉取请求中的冲突相同),然后将结果提交到workbranch
  • workbranch推送到您的遥控器

在bitbucket上:

  • 打开拉取请求,将workbranch合并到master